Definitions

  • the invention relates to. a method for firing rooftiles in roller hearth kilns.
  • the invention is useful in firing rooftiles of the type known as Portuguese tiles or pantiles, or the like.
  • Pantiles comprise plain tiles with a straight central zone and a bent zone for overlapping an adjacent tile, or plain hollow tiles with a slight S-shape, or Roman tiles with a straight central zone and a large-radius bent overlapping zone.
  • All of the tiles are characterised by complex shapes, and they are not singly provided with flat surfaces permitting of simple and sure resting on roller type continuous conveyors.
  • one commonly adopted solution is that of tunnel kilns using traditional cars loaded with the piled material, or using special auxiliary firing means constituted by supports made in U-shaped crates made in refractory material, each predisposed to receive a certain number of tiles, normally stacked vertically.
  • the supports can be piled one on the other to form several tile layers.
  • tunnel kilns are envisaged but with the use of cars whereon the tiles are piled, lying horizontally, by means of special supports which can be jointed one on top of the other to form a pile.
  • each tile rests on and is supported by its own refractory support, the presence of which guarantees, during firing, a perfect maintenance of the shape of the tile and thus a successful end product.
  • roller hearth kilns In the floor- and wall-tile industry roller hearth kilns are used, which are slao functionally suitable for smooth surface-covering tiles. Roller hearth kilns of this type are both smaller and provide a considerably shorter firing time.
  • a principal aim of the present invention is to obviate the drawbacks and limits of the prior art realisations, through a method permitting of firing in particular complex-shape tiles in roller-hearth kilns without the need to use special auxiliary supports for firing the tiles.
  • a roof tile made by pressing with a ceramic material, including a central zone and an overlapping bend, which has on a bottom side thereof at least two reinforcing running ribs provided for resting the tile on the rollers of a roller hearth kiln, and on an upper side thereof and in the area of a longitudinal edge thereof and an opposite side of the overlapping bend there is provided a rest plane for an external inferior edge of the overlapping bend of an identical contiguous tile.
  • Pressed roof tiles formed in this way may be continuously fed through the roller hearth kiln without the use of any special auxiliary supports such that the tiles are securely supported by the running ribs on the rollers of the trollers hearth kiln and by the inferior edge of the overlapping bend resting on the rest plane of the preceding tile. It is important that in the supporting area of the inferior edge of overlapping bend no overlaoad of of material occurs.
  • the running ribs preferably extend in transversal direction of the tile, but may also extend in longitudinal directions.
  • additional support rollers for supporting the overlapping bend at the inferior edge thereof may be provided in the roller hearth kiln, preferably only in a softening zone thereof.
  • the length of the laying planes of the running ribs being greater than the axial distance between two rollers ensures a secure support of the running ribs on at least two rollers at any time.
  • 1 denotes a tile of the type known as a Portuguese tile or Roman tile, characterised in that it has a quite complex geometrical shape. It belongs to tile typologies that can be schematically defined, from the geometrical point of view, as being constituted by a curved part, similar to a cover, connected with a flatter part. The curved part has an edge for coupling and superposing it on the corresponding flat zone, which can joint with another, contiguous tile.
  • the tile 1 soffit, apart from having the usual hooking projections 10, jointing crossribs 11 and various joints and notches, all of which have the function of guaranteeing good connection between the tiles and ease of laying, also has ribs 12 (three in the embodiment shown) arranged exclusively with the aim of identifying an ideal flat laying surface for the tiles 1.
  • the ribs 12 are arranged transversally and exhibit a length such as to ensure a continuous lay on the rollers 3 of a roller plane 2 of a roller hearth kiln 4 for firing ceramic products.
  • the length of the ribs 12 should be as a rule at least twice the length of the interaxis between two rollers 3.
  • the transversal arrangement of the ribs 12 is in accordance with the arrangement of the tiles 1 on the rollers 3, that is, the direction of the tiles 1 themselves with respect to the advancement direction of the entire roller plane 2 formed by the rollers 3.
  • the ribs 12 provide a flat surface for laying the tiles 1 on the rollers 3 thanks to the presence of which the projecting functional elements, such as the hooking projections 10, the various profiles and the various jointing crossribs 11, are situated on the same plane or above the laying plane configured by the ribs 12.
  • the arrangement of the ribs 12 permits thus of laying a part of the soffit of the tile 1 on a roller plane 3, so as to permit the unproblematic movement of the tile 1 itself along the roller plane 2.
  • the ribs 12 extend over a large part of the soffit of the tile 1 with the exclusion of the curved zone of the tile 1 at which zone there is a lateral overlapping edge 13.
  • the said lateral overlapping edge 13 is predisposed to insert and couple, during its laying, in the special joint seating 14 made in proximity to the corresponding opposite lateral edge of the lateral overlapping edge 13 of an identical and contiguous tile 1.
  • the tiles 1 can be arranged on the roller plane 2 simply in line one behind the other, or in a sort of chain fashion.
  • the tiles 1, laid with their relative ribs 12 on the rollers 3, are consecutively coupled one to the next in such a way that the lateral overlapping edge 13 of a single tile 1 is inserted into the joint seating 14 of the immediately following tile 1.
  • This arrangement represnted in figure 6, reproduces the configuration which will be used when the tiles are actually laid on a roof.
  • the coupling of the tiles 1 to form a chain can be easily realised according to the embodiment shown in figure 5, by means of the use of projecting elements 15 in the form of a shelf from the lateral edge of each single tile 1 opposite to the lateral overlapping edge 13.
  • the presence of the projecting elements 15 made on the piece does not prejudice the functionality of the tile 1 and allows an ordered line of tiles 1 to be created, in which the lateral overlapping edge 13 of a tile 1 can rest couplingly on the elements 15 of the following tile 1 without interfering with the zones of the functional elements of the tile 1 itself, that is, without being and remaining directly coupled and inserted, during the firing phase, in the joint seating 14 which is destined to receive the lateral overlapping edge 13 when laid.
  • the arrangement realises, thanks to the presence of the ribs 12 and the possiblity of the lateral overlapping edges' 13 stable resting of the single tiles 1 arranged in a line and coupled one consecutively to the other on any roller conveyor, and thus, in particular, on the roller planes usually used in roller hearth kilns for firing ceramic materials.
  • the stability of the arrangement adopted is such that the tiles 1 maintain, during the firing process, together with a correct orientation with respect to the rollers, also all the characteristics of shape and function that are indispensable for their correct functioning when laid.
  • the tile comprises a central zone 101 and by an overlapping bend 102.
  • On the bottom side there are three running ribs 103 arranged transversally with respect to the longitudinal direction of the tile, with horizontal laying planes 104 for resting on the rollers of a roller hearth kiln.
  • the length of the laying planes 104 of the ribs 103, at least on the side of the head and the foot of the tile, is greater than double the axial distance between two rollers of the roller hearth kiln.
  • the running ribs 103 further comprise by inclined surfaces 105 for easy insertion on the rollers of the roller hearth kiln.
  • a laying surface 107 is envisaged for the external inferior edge 108 of the overlapping bend 109 of a similar tile.
  • the laying surface 107 is provided with two projections 109 on the opposite side from the overlapping bend 102, which projections 109 are formed on the longitudinal edge 106 of the tile opposite to the overlapping bend 102.
  • Each of the projections 109 further exhibits a locking rib 110 projecting from the laying plane 107, which guarantees a perfect blocking of two tiles when the laying surface 107 and the inferior edge of the overlapping bend 108 of an adjacent tile is arranged on the laying plane 107.
  • the running ribs 103 on the side of the head and on the side of the foot of the tile with a relative laying surface are continued on the inferior side of the projections 109 up to the external edges of the projections. Further, these two ribs 103 are arranged in such a way as not to interfere with either the roof beams or the covering.
  • both the inferior edge of the overlapping bend 108 and the laying surface 107 are kept free of glaze, so that the pieces cannot become glued together during firing.
  • Figure 11 shows a hollow plain tile according to the invention, as described with respect to figures from 8 to 10, with a view of the foot of one tile with the overlapping bend of the successive tile at the moment of the passage through the kiln.
  • Figure 12 shows a section of a Roman tile according to the invention, with the overlapping bend 102 of the adjacent Roman tile laying on it during the passage through the roller hearth kiln.
  • the Roman tile is distinct from the hollow plain tile described in figures from 8 to 11 because it does not exhibit projections 109, but rather is provided with an according laying surface 111 for the inferior edge of the overlapping bend 102 adjacent to a lateral upper rib 112. All of the other characteristics correspond to those described for figures from 8 to 11.
  • Figure 13 shows a plain barrel tile according to the invention in a similar view to the Roman tile of figure 12. No projections 109 are envisaged here, and the laying surface 111 of the inferior projection of the overlapping bend 108 is formed by the bottom of the external lateral groove.
  • figure 14 shows a hollow plain tile according to the invention, shown like the Roman tile of figure 12 and the plain barrel tile of figure 13.
  • This hollow plain tile also has no projections 109.
  • the laying surface 111 for the inferior edge 108 of the overlapping bend 102 is structured as the bottom of an external lateral groove situated lower, adjacent to the lateral upper rib 112.
  • an additional laying surface can be provided for the external projection 108 of its overlapping bend 102, on a separate shaped ceramic piece (not illustrated).
  • Both the laying surface 107 and the laying surface 111 of the inferior projection of the overlapping bend 108 are structured and arranged in such a way as not to lead, during firing in a roller hearth kiln, to an overload of the material.
  • Another possible alternative is to arrange the ribs 103 longitudinally with respect to the tile and to equip the roller hearth kiln with additional support rollers for the inferior edge 108 of the overlapping bend 102 at least in the softening zone of the roller hearth kiln.

Claims (3)

  1. Verfahren zum Brennen von Ziegeln in Rollenöfen, bei welchem die Ziegel (1) direkt auf einer Rollenfläche (2) von einem Rollenofen (4) angeordnet werden; wobei jeder der Ziegel (1) an wenigstens einem Teil einer - Wölbfläche mit zusätzlichen Auflagemitteln versehen ist, um eine ideale Auflagefläche zu bilden, dank welcher die verschiedenen hervorstehenden Elemente, wie Einhakansätze (10), Verbindungsrippen (11) und ähnliche, sich nicht unterhalb der Auflagefläche befinden; wobei die genannten Auflagemittel an einem Teil der Wölbfläche eines jeden genannten Ziegels (1) wenigstens zwei Rippen (12) enthalten, welche eine ideale Auflagefläche bilden und parallel zu einer Vorschubrichtung des auf der Rollenfläche (2) liegenden Ziegels (1) angeordnet sind; wobei die Länge der Rippen (12) wenigstens der doppelten Länge des Achsenabstandes zwischen zwei aufeinanderfolgenden Rollen (3) der Rollenfläche (2) entspricht; d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ass die Ziegel (1), welche auf einer Rollenfläche (2) angeordnet sind, mit Hilfe der Rippen (12) auf dieser liegen und dabei einer mit dem anderen verbunden sind, um durch die gegenseitige Verbindung zwischen den sich gegenüberliegenden seitlichen Kanten der Ziegel (1) eine Kette zu bilden.
  2. Verfahren nach Patentansp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ass die Verbindung zwischen den sich gegenüberliegenden seitlichen Kanten der Ziegel (1) erhalten wird durch Einlegen einer Deckwulstkante (13) eines Ziegels (1) in wenigstens ein schalenförmig ausgebildetes hervorstehendes Element (15), das speziell in die der seitlichen Deckwulstkante (13) gegenüberliegenden seitlichen Kante eines gleichartigen Ziegels (1) eingearbeitet ist, letzterer angrenzend an den ersten angeordnet.
  3. Verfahren nach Patentansp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ass die Verbindung zwischen den sich gegenüberliegenden seit-lichen Kanten der Ziegel (1) erhalten wird durch Einlegen einer Deckwulstkante (13) eines Ziegels (1) in einen Verbindungssitz (14), welcher bei einem gleichartigen und angrenzend angeordneten Ziegel (1) in der Nähe einer Kante eingearbeitet ist, die der Deckwulstkante (13) gegenüberliegt, um die Verbindung der Ziegel (1) auf gleiche Weise auch während des anschliessenden Dachdeckens zu erlauben.
